网站大量收购独家精品文档,联系QQ:2885784924

关系数据库的理论基础.pptVIP

  1. 1、本文档共10页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

数据管理技术的发展01数据描述与数据模型02关系代数03数据依赖的概念04关系模型规范化理论05概念结构设计工具E-R方法06逻辑结构设计(二维表格设计)07关系数据库的理论基础特点:数据与应用程序一一对应,且由程序员自己管理。特点:由操作系统的文件系统管理,实现了按名存取。大量冗余、不能共享、不能反映数据之间的联系。特点:主要解决了数据共享的问题。数据是结构化的,面向系统,冗余度小数据具有独立性保证了数据的完整性、安全性和并发性人工管理阶段文件管理阶段管理库管理阶段数据管理技术的发展信息:客观事物在人们头脑中的反映。1实体:信息的主要对象,可指人、物、抽象的事件、2事物与事物之间的联系。3信息世界几个概念:属性、实体型、实体值、实体集4数据:信息的文字和符号表示。5数据模型:现实世界中的客观事物及其联系在数据世6界中的描述。7数据世界几个概念:数据项、记录型、记录值、文件、关键字8实体间的联系:一对一(1:1)一对多(1:m)多对多(m:n)9数据描述数据描述与数据模型(一)数据描述与数据模型(二)数据模型数据模型:现实世界中的客观事物及其联系在数据世界中的描述。数据的不同组织形成了不同的数据模型。常用的三种数据模型:1、层次模型:树状结构2、网状模型:多棵树结构3、关系模型:二维表结构关系模型的优点:数据结构简单、很高的数据独立性、可以直接处理多对多的联系、有坚实的理论基础。A并运算n元关系R和n元关系S记作:RSB差运算n元关系R和n元关系S记作:R-SC交运算n元关系R和n元关系S记作:RSD笛卡尔积m元关系R和n元关系S记作:RSE选择运算在指定关系中选择满足条件的记录(元组)F投影运算在指定关系中选择满足条件的字段(域)关系代数运算部份依赖是通过一个关系中数据间值依赖关系体现出来的数据间的相互关系,是现实世界属性间相互关系的抽象,是数据内在的性质。完全依赖传递依赖数据依赖数据依赖的概念问题的提出现实世界的多种实体及其联系,可以用关系的形式或二维表表示,这种关系一般都是非规范化的。规范化减少数据的冗余,保证数据库设计的稳定和灵活,消除插入异常、删除异常和修改麻烦。第一范式(1NF)第二范式(2NF)第三范式(3NF)关系模型规范化理论概念结构设计工具E-R方法E-R(Entity-Relationship)方法:实体-联系方法,是描述与定义现实世界信息和内在联系的工具。实体间的联系:一对一(1:1)一对多(1:m)多对多(m:n)其中:实体框联系框属性框班长L班级C学生S系DL-CD-SC-S11课程C学生Sn1nm实体联系图Dnm学时名称成绩01课程号学号02学号姓名03课程号性别04课程D年龄05学生S班级

文档评论(0)

135****1732 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档